What affects the price

Electricians determine their rates based on several key factors. First, the complexity of the task matters; replacing a simple outlet is much faster than upgrading an entire electrical panel or rewiring a room. The accessibility of the work area also plays a role, as jobs in cramped attics or crawl spaces often require more time and labor. Do electricians do HVAC in Cape Coral?

Electricians in Cape Coral are responsible for the electrical connections and wiring of HVAC systems, ensuring proper power and safe installation. They are vital for the electrical installation service related to HVAC units. However, the actual repair and maintenance of the HVAC equipment itself is handled by a separate HVAC technician.
